(-11-10i)^2<br> I just need to know the steps to get to the answer.
jeka57 [31]

Answer:

21 + 220i

Step-by-step explanation:

reminder that i² = - 1

(- 11 - 10i)²

= (- 11 - 10i)(- 11 - 10i) ← expand using FOIL

= 121 + 110I + 110I + 100I²

= 121 + 220I + 100(- 1)

= 121 + 220i - 100

= 21 + 220i
